Sikhs in the City Dawn to Dusk Marathon & Ultra 2026
This event uses a certified 2.014 km loop on mostly good tarmac in the car park area of Teresa Gavin House / Mulalley & Co, Southend Road, Woodford Green IG8 8FA. The course is described as undulating and wheelchair friendly. Chip timing is used and lap times are displayed on a large electronic board at the start/finish.
Medals are awarded for completing lap targets on the loop: 11 laps for a 22 km medal, 21 laps for a marathon medal, and 25 laps for an ultra medal. The Team Relay Ultra is a fixed 50 km distance (25 laps) for teams of up to five runners; only the team captain enters team details. Team entries are limited to 20 to control the number of runners on course.
Basic facilities include bag drop, toilets and a feeding station at the start/finish serving drinks, savouries, biscuits, chocolates, fruit, tea and coffee, plus samosa and onion bhaji, and a separate table for personal drinks. The event provides paramedics and marshals and is fully insured. The course is certified for distance and the marathon and ultra count towards 100 Marathon Club totals.
Entry limits and fees are published. Entries are limited in number and close on 25 November 2026. The organiser operates a no refund policy with a one year deferral to specified future events.
